Transaction 64e17b5d3dc903cf76a1599a707c098b1d14b3b959afdb1c205122e9eeee6666
1 Input
2 Outputs
- 64e17b5d3dc903cf76a1599a707c098b1d14b3b959afdb1c205122e9eeee6666:0
- 64e17b5d3dc903cf76a1599a707c098b1d14b3b959afdb1c205122e9eeee6666:1
value 21031518
address 1MYPrehkccUsaybUHWq8NDtEFKC6pYG7ZU
value 69856228
address 1EtcfCHbwfbPkFxL9eTvQwXGSFEo1QSpxy